Dog accompanying monks on peace walk recovering after surgery

COLUMBIA, S.C. (WIS) – Aloka, the dog accompanying a group of Buddhist monks on their peace walk to Washington, is recovering after a successful surgery on Monday.

The Buddhist monks’ Facebook account announced Aloka had a successful surgery and is in recovery.

“We extend our heartfelt gratitude to the incredible medical team at Charleston Veterinary Referral Center (CVRC) for their extraordinary compassion and generosity,” the post read.

The post says Aloka’s surgery was finished in an hour, and he is in recovery, resting under close medical care…
